Hi,

I am working on a theme and trying to find the scrollbar code to change it for when you post a reply in the forums. All the other scrollbars match my theme except this one. I cant seem to find it. Any guidance please?

I saw your post earlier Matt about the images, but haven't had time to post back yet. Are you talking about the module buttons at the top of the My Account page? Like for Info, Messages, Themes, etc.?

Sorry. I don't even know about the scroll bar you're referring to. It seems to me that the scrollbar code for the theme would also apply to the textareas. Unless textareas have a different class or id. Check to see if there is a class assigned, or an id, or if the textarea is sitting inside a <div> tag. Also, If you have any mods installed, like the BB Encode mod, check to see if it has a stylesheet of it's own that controls the textarea.

Yep..thats what I was referring to. Was wondering if thats in the form of a custom shape set or if it has to be custom made.



I don't know that there is a particular "set" of module buttons. I think it's just a matter of coming up with something that will match the design of the theme. What I have done is set up a .psd template with the icon on a layer and the background on a layer for each button. That way I can use the same icon and just swap out the backgrounds.

I do the same thing for forum images and topic buttons. Saves loads of time in not having to recreate certain parts every time. (Giving away trade secrets here. icon_wink.gif )

As far as your scrollbar goes, I took a look at the CSS for some of the themes here. The attributes for the scrollbars are set in the body class. The textareas inherit them. That's how it normally works. Only the background colors, images, text, borders, etc are set up in the class for the textarea.

If you'll post your CSS file, I'll take a look and see if I can find anything different in yours.

textarea{border-color: #FBAF0D; color:#FBAF0D; background-color: #DBDBDB; font:normal 11px Verdana,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if}

input.post,textarea.post{background:#DBDBDB;color:#000000;
font:10px Verdana,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if;padding-bottom:2px;padding-left:2px;
border:1px solid;border-color: #FBAF0D #FBAF0D #FBAF0D #FBAF0D}


Here are the lines that pertain to your textareas. There's nothing there to prevent them from inheriting the information for the scrollbars from the body. icon_neutral.gif

One thing I did just notice, and this might be a matter of not seeing the forest for the trees, is that the scrollbars are greyed out on this forum until you put in enough text to need them. Maybe that's the problem? Try filling up the textarea with enough text to make it scroll and see what happens.
